Full Job Description

You will be working in our multi professional teams which are led by highly specialist Occupational Therapists and Physiotherapists.

You will demonstrate a holistic approach to patient care, joint therapy working and service development.Your will use your assessment, treatment, and discharge planning skills.

You will be involved in the development of the services you are based in,

You will supervise junior staff and students.

You will be encouraged to consolidate your knowledge and develop your clinical and non-clinical skills through CPD within supportive team environments.

You will receive regular supervision and be part of an active band 6 peer group.

You will contribute to a weekend service.

MFT is one of the largest NHS Trust In England with a turnover of £2.6bn & is on a different scale than most other NHS Trusts. We're creating an exceptional integrated health & social care system for the 1 million patients who rely on our services every year.

Bringing together 10 hospitals & community services from across Manchester, Trafford & beyond, we champion collaborative working & transformation, encouraging our 28,000 workforce to pursue their most ambitious goals. We set standards that other Trusts seek to emulate so you'll benefit from a scale of opportunity that is nothing short of extraordinary.

We've also created a digitally enabled organisation to improve clinical quality, patient & staff experience, operational effectiveness & driving research, and innovation through the introduction of Hive; our Electronic Patient Record system which launched in September 2022.

We're proud to be a major academic Research Centre & Education provider, providing you with a robust infrastructure to encourage and facilitate high-quality research programmes.
